1. Simple to use

If you want a machine that does the work for you, there are a variety of models to choose from. Most popular are capsule machines with automatics, which allow you to insert pods by pressing a single button. Some are semiautomatics which require you to manually fill the portafilter, but they use an electric pump to ensure a consistent pressure and flow. Many of these machines include a milk frother for making cappuccinos and lattes. Fully automated machines are more expensive but can do everything for you, including grinding coffee and brewing it, as well as heating and frothing milk.

You'll need to refill your espresso maker more often if you choose a smaller size. However, they're generally more accessible and have a lower profile so they can be placed under cabinets.

2. Easy to clean

A small espresso machine can be an excellent addition to any office or home especially for those who like their coffee with a little some milk. It is essential to keep in mind that these machines espresso are a challenge to clean. This is because mini espresso machine machines require a lot of water, and they require regular cleaning to ensure that they are working well and producing the best tasting coffee possible.

There are a variety of methods to clean an espresso machine, but one of the most effective methods is to use a cleaning solution that is specifically designed for espresso machines. This solution can be made with citric, vinegar, or commercial descaling products. Descale your espresso machine at least every two months.

Rinse the steam wand and group heads after each use. This will prevent the buildup of coffee oil and other residues which can affect the flavor. To do this, first turn off the water supply to the espresso machine. You will also need to remove the portafilters of the group heads. Brush the heads of the group using a coffee brush or a tool. Next, spray the inside of the group head as well as dispersion screens with a cleaning solution. Finally, clean the gaskets for the group head and the group head with cool water.

3. Easy to maintain

Making coffee at home required lots of effort and skill, but the best new models make it virtually foolproof. They also cost less than ever before and take up a much smaller footprint on the counter.

The best small espresso maker is easy to maintain and will aid in keeping your kitchen organized and tidy. A clean coffee maker will produce better coffee and last longer. It's important to be on top of the maintenance tasks, including rinsing and cleaning the drip tray and group head, as well as decaling the water tank.

Traditional coffee machines should be washed with soapy water hot after each use and given a thorough clean at least once every six months. Espresso machines require cleaning more frequently and at least once a week. This is due to the fact that parts of espresso machines are more likely to accumulate dirt and dirt.

Filters and ports are blocked. They are the most frequent cause of failures in espresso machine coffee machines. These blockages can occur because of poor tamping or grinding, or because the solubles present in the coffee haven't been completely extracted. The blockages could also be caused by a absence of regular cleaning.

The best way to avoid this is to stick to regular. Clean the baskets, portafilters and gaskets regularly, and scrub the group heads and steam wands thoroughly to remove any stuck coffee grounds. Detergent is available for this task, but certain people prefer a solution of water and distilled vinegar instead.
